Commercial conference room AV across California — video conferencing, displays, room audio, and control systems for huddle rooms, boardrooms, and training centers. Access Cabling installs Zoom Rooms, Microsoft Teams Rooms, Cisco Webex, Poly, Logitech Rally, Neat, and Crestron/Extron control.

Control and scheduling

Room scheduling display outside every room (Crestron TSS, Evoko Liso, Logitech Tap Scheduler) tied to Outlook or Google Workspace. In-room touch controller for the video platform. Optional building-wide control system (Crestron, Extron, or Q-SYS) for AV routing and lighting scenes.

Standardize the room, standardize the outcome

The most reliable path to good conference rooms is picking a room standard and repeating it. For most commercial deployments that means Microsoft Teams Rooms or Zoom Rooms on a Logitech Rally, Neat Bar, or Poly Studio bundle — camera + speakerphone + touch controller with a single certified appliance. Boardrooms and training centers get modular systems (Crestron/Extron control, dedicated camera, DSP audio, in-ceiling mics).

Can existing cable be reused during a Conference Room AV refresh in Norwalk?+

Sometimes. On Norwalk refresh projects we Fluke-test the existing plant first: if runs pass CAT6 or CAT6A channel spec and pathways are clean, they stay. Anything failing certification, abandoned per NEC 800.25, or unlabeled gets removed and replaced. You get a channel-by-channel keep/replace decision — not a blanket rip-and-replace bill.

Do you handle wireless presentation?+

Yes — Barco ClickShare, Airtame, Solstice, and Logitech Swytch for wireless laptop share. Configured for guest and BYOD use.
